Pattern of Patent-Based Renewable Energy Technology Innovation in China

Renewable Energy sources could provide a solution to enhance energy efficiency and air pollution governance, and is one of the key strategies to address sustainable development. Renewable energy technology innovation is a fundamental determinant of energy-saving and pollution management performance. This paper profiles and classifies renewable energy patents and uses visual techniques to examine their innovation capabilities. A renewable energy patents dataset derived from China's State Intellectual Property Office (SIPO) containing 49,460 renewable energy invention patents granted between 1985 and 2014 was constructed. The temporal and spatial distribution of renewable energy patents shows that eastern provinces had the majority of renewable energy patents, which denote that renewable energy science is geographically concentrated. Drilling further, it is confirmed that a clear pattern of concentration of renewable energy knowledge generation in a small number of big cities. The pattern of renewable energy patents by features and ownership indicates that enterprise plays a very important role in renewable energy innovation and university also attributes a lot.
